Foot Massage

A foot massage uses 4 varieties of massage strokes on the feet and lower leg. The depth of strokes will determine whether the massage is intended to be a relaxation massage, a deep tissue massage or a remedial massage.
 

Step 1 - Warm Up

It is important to start your massage by warming up and increasing the blood flow to the feet.

Start by placing warm hands on the top and bottom of the foot you are going to massage. When warm squeeze hands together and release a few times (with the foot still in between the hands). Then squeeze hands together at the bottom of the foot and whilst still applying comfortable pressure to the foot sweep the hands to the end of the toes and repeat this motion a few times.

Step 2 - Top of the Foot

Now is the time to apply a quality massage oil to your hands (make sure you warm up the oil before massaging).

Place both thumbs on the top of the foot between the bones and place fingers on the sole of the foot. Applying comfortable pressure slide the thumbs and fingers from the top of the foot down the grove between the bones to the ankle and back up to the toes. Repeat the motion several times for each grove.
 

Step 3 - Bottom of the Foot

Using both thumbs apply comfortable pressure to middle part of the heel. In a single motion move both thumbs up the arch of the foot to the gap between the big and second toe and back down to the heel. Repeat the motion several times.

Place one hand under the ankle and then using one thumb make a circular motion on the base of the foot from the heel, through the arch and onto the ball of the foot. Repeat the circular motion from the ball of the foot to the heel. Repeat the circular motion several times and make sure you massage all areas on the sole of the foot.

 

Step 4 - The Toes

Finally starting with the big toe using your thumb and forefinger make circular motions from the base to the tip of the toe and back to the base again. Repeat this motion several times and then wiggle each toe forwards, backwards and side to side.

Repeat the circular motion and wiggling for each toe.

 

Step 5 - Warm Down

Once you have massaged each toe then repeat Step 1 for each foot.

 

Reflexology Foot Zones

Foot reflexology believes that there are 4 zones in your feet and massaging each zone has a corresponding affect on another part of your body.
